1907 Club is an organization that, through promoting the principles of Alcoholics Anonymous, supports the families and those suffering with alcoholism or other addictions to recover, stay sober, and be in fellowship with others in recovery. We offer 12-Step AA, Al-anon, and All-Recovery meetings through out the week. In addition to our six meeting rooms, our building includes a large entertainment
hall with a full kitchen and an open coffee bar with lounge area and two pool tables. We have ample parking and an outdoor recreation area including a fire pit.
